localized dilation of a blood vessel wall that introduces the risk of a rupture is known as:

Answers

Answer 1

Answer:

Aneurysm

Explanation:

Localized dilation of a blood vessel wall that introduces the risk of a rupture is known as an aneurysm. An aneurysm is an abnormal bulging or ballooning of a blood vessel caused by weakness in the vessel wall. If left untreated, an aneurysm can grow larger over time and potentially rupture, leading to severe bleeding and other complications. Aneurysms can occur in various blood vessels, including the arteries in the brain (cerebral aneurysm), aorta (aortic aneurysm), and other arteries throughout the body.

The function of coenzyme A in the citric acid cycle is most like Group of answer choices a limousine driver dropping off a couple at the school prom. a kid jumping up and down on a trampoline. a frog that turns into a prince. throwing a baited hook into a lake and catching a fish.

Answers

Answer:

a limousine driver dropping off a couple at the school prom

Explanation:

The citric acid cycle, also known as the Krebs cycle, is a metabolic pathway by which carbohydrates, lipids and amino acids can be oxidized to carbon dioxide (CO2) and water (H2O). Coenzyme A (CoA) is a key coenzyme in the citric acid cycle. Coenzyme A acts as a carrier of acyl groups: its acetyl-coenzyme A form delivers the acetyl group to the citric acid cycle in order to be oxidized for energy production. During the citric acid cycle, Coenzyme A delivers the acetyl group to oxaloacetate (a four-carbon molecule), in order to form citrate (a six-carbon molecule that contains three carboxyl groups). Subsequently, citrate is oxidized and decarboxylated to produce a succinyl CoA, 2 CO2, and 2 NADH.

A 6.4 KD protein is digested with trypsin to generate fragments with masses of 666 Da, 721 Da, 759 Da, 844 Da, 912 Da, 1028 Da and 1486 Da. a. Draw an SDS-PAGE of the peptides and label each band with the appropriate mass. Be sure to include a standard ladder on your gel.

Answers

The SDS-PAGE gel would show bands corresponding to the digested protein fragments with masses of 666 Da, 721 Da, 759 Da, 844 Da, 912 Da, 1028 Da, and 1486 Da. A standard ladder should be included for reference.

SDS-PAGE (Sodium Dodecyl Sulfate-Polyacrylamide Gel Electrophoresis) is a common technique used to separate proteins based on their molecular weight. In this case, the 6.4 KD (kilodalton) protein has been digested with trypsin, an enzyme that cleaves proteins at specific sites. The resulting fragments have different masses, which can be visualized on an SDS-PAGE gel.

The gel would consist of a polyacrylamide matrix through which an electric field is applied. The negatively charged SDS molecules bind to the proteins, causing them to unfold and acquire a negative charge proportional to their size. As a result, the proteins migrate towards the positive electrode during electrophoresis, with smaller proteins moving faster and migrating farther through the gel.

By running the digested protein fragments alongside a protein standard ladder, which contains proteins of known molecular weights, we can estimate the size of the fragments based on their migration distance. Each fragment would appear as a distinct band on the gel, and the position of the band relative to the ladder can be used to determine its molecular weight.

In this case, the gel would show bands corresponding to the fragments with masses of 666 Da, 721 Da, 759 Da, 844 Da, 912 Da, 1028 Da, and 1486 Da. The ladder bands would serve as reference points, allowing us to assign the appropriate mass to each fragment band.

which type of endocytosis ingests the most specific type of molecule?

Answers

“Receptor mediated endocytosis”
Is the answer

The type of endocytosis that ingests the most specific type of molecule is receptor-mediated endocytosis. This process involves the binding of specific molecules, such as hormones or growth factors, to their corresponding receptors on the cell membrane.

Once the ligand-receptor complex is formed, it triggers the formation of clathrin-coated pits, which are specialized regions of the cell membrane. These pits then invaginate and pinch off to form vesicles that transport the ligand-receptor complex into the cell.

Receptor-mediated endocytosis is a highly selective process because it relies on the specificity of ligand-receptor interactions. Only molecules that can bind to specific receptors on the cell surface are internalized, while other molecules are excluded. This process is particularly important for the uptake of essential nutrients, such as cholesterol and iron, which cannot enter the cell through passive diffusion.

Overall, receptor-mediated endocytosis is a critical mechanism for maintaining homeostasis and regulating cellular processes. By selectively internalizing specific molecules, cells can control their internal environment and respond to external stimuli in a precise and coordinated manner.
